VA Offering Dental Insurance Program for the First Time Ever

Posted by Gregory M. Rada | November 27, 2013 | Health Benefits

The VA announced earlier this month the start of theย VA Dental Insurance Program (VADIP),ย which allows veterans who are enrolled in VA health care to purchase dental insurance through Delta Dental orย MetLife.
